A quiet space during rush hour: Quiescence in primordial germ cells

Quiescence is a common character in stem cells. Low cellular activity in these cells may function to minimize the potential damaging effects of oxidative stress, reduce the number of cells needed for tissue replenishment, and as a consequence, perhaps occupy unique niches.
